Message type: E = Error
Message class: /EACC/FOBU -
Message number: 000
Message text: Enter a data basis

- Enter a data basis ?The SAP error message
/EACC/FOBU000 Enter a data basis
typically occurs in the context of the SAP Financial Accounting (FI) or Controlling (CO) modules, particularly when dealing with financial documents or postings. This error indicates that a required field, specifically the "data basis," has not been filled in or is missing.Cause:
- Missing Data Basis: The most common cause of this error is that the user has not entered a value in the "data basis" field, which is necessary for the transaction to proceed.
- Configuration Issues: There may be configuration settings in the system that require a data basis to be specified for certain transactions.
- User Input Error: The user may have overlooked the field or entered an invalid value that the system does not recognize.
Solution:
- Enter Data Basis: The immediate solution is to ensure that the "data basis" field is filled in correctly. Check the documentation or help text associated with the field to understand what values are acceptable.
- Review Configuration: If you are a system administrator or have access to configuration settings, review the settings related to the transaction to ensure that the data basis is correctly configured.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for specific guidance on the transaction you are working with. This may provide insights into what is expected in the data basis field.
- User Training: If this error is common among users, consider providing training or creating documentation to help users understand the importance of the data basis field and how to fill it out correctly.
